## Authentication

Bulk edits in the Orchardpane admin table go through the `/bulk/apply` endpoint, which requires an elevated service token rather than a user session. Edits over 500 rows are chunked automatically and logged to the audit stream. If you're on call and need to run an emergency bulk revert, authenticate with the key below.

gateway credential: kto23_LX9A4ys6i4nzHtpOLNLodKK

## Step 4: Regenerate your Lintbarrow baseline

Quick one for the sync: after bumping to Lintbarrow 2.x, your old baseline file is basically a liar — rule IDs got renamed, so half the suppressions silently stopped matching. Delete the stale baseline, run the analyzer once in record mode, and commit the fresh file alongside the config. Don't hand-edit entries; the checksum header will reject you. For reference, the analyzer should be running with these exact settings when you record.

config for bawig-fadup:
[zorix]
host = zorix.lumicworks.corp
user = zorix_svc
database = zorix_prod

For the weekly sync: this PR adds blue-green deploy support to the Pennwright billing worker. The worker now registers with the Halverd router under a color label, and traffic cuts over only after the idle pool drains its in-flight invoices. Rollback is a single label flip, and we keep the old color warm for a configurable window. Queue consumers pause during cutover rather than rebalancing, which avoids the duplicate-charge risk we saw in staging. Cutover timing is governed by these constants.

tuning constants:
QUOTAS = {
    "aldax": 698,
    "druix": 831,
    "wenir": 483,
    "juleth": 963,
    "drumir": 118,
}

- [ ] **Step 7: Breaker override escrow.** After sealing the signing keys for the Tallgrove upstream API circuit breaker, confirm the support team can force the breaker open during a full outage. The override bundle lives in the sealed escrow drawer and is useless without its unlock phrase. Two ceremony witnesses must initial this step before proceeding. The escrow bundle is decrypted with the recovery passphrase that follows.

vault phrase of kahip-kahop = holath-quenmir